Don't expect the Duo-Therm to use conventional wire color codes, I wish I could help more, I upgraded my DuoTherm analog thermostat to a modern Honeywell battery powered unit last year.  Unfortunately yours appears to be even older than my old DuoTherm analog and may use different voltages.  As I recall mine used a 7.5V electrical system, not 24V like traditional home units.

p.s. the extra wire may be the hi/low fan speed control
